Sarah Gibson was understandably anxious about the journey that lay ahead of her, when she was diagnosed with breast cancer.
With many bumps along the way, including two spells of anaphylactic shock before her bilateral mastectomy surgery, the 45-year-old mum of two says she couldn’t have got through it without her McGrath Breast Care Nurse, Sarah Maguire.
